> Got a chance to take a new Fusion V6 out for a drive yesterday. 
> 
> I have to say it is a nice car.  Based on the Mazda 6, it seems to 
> have 
> a bit more room inside, I think they stretched the platform a 
> little. 
> 
> I was a bit disappointed that in the top version, there is NO 
> provision 
> for shifting the tranny, no wheel buttons, no detents on the 
> shifter 
> other than D and L.   No autostick option.  Not that most people 
> use 
> one, but it would be nice to have some nod to the enthusiast.
> 
> Build quality looks very good, lots of interior room for the 
> class, and 
> good trunk space.  Power is good, but I would not say it was a 
> replacement for the SHO.  I would go for one of these possibly if 
> they 
> were to bring power level up some, but the base suspension seemed 
> quite 
> good.
> 
> All up price is right at $25,000 with every option available.
> 
> All in all, a pretty nice car for Ford to offer.  Would be nice if 
> it 
> could have been an all American design, but using chassis and 
> expertise 
> from a corporate cousin is why Ford bought into Mazda, to get some 
> of 
> that to use elsewhere.  It is a good addition to Ford and probably 
> the 
> best sedan they offer right now.
